Quantum computing team makes breakthrough as PM heaps praise

It’s an exciting time to be in quantum computing. On the very same day that Prime Minister Malcolm Turnbull described University of New South Wales research in the field as “the best work in the world”, the team behind it all reported a breakthrough.
